Appendix C
Table C-l lists the error messages associated with the Form C Switch
module programmed by SCPI. See the appropriate mainframe manual for a
complete list of error messages.
Table C-1. Form C Switch Error Messages
Potential Cause(s)
Trigger received when scan not enabled. Trigger received after scan
complete. Trigger too fast.
Attempting to execute an INIT command when a scan is already in progress.
Attempting to execute a command with a parameter not applicable to the
command.
Assigning an external trigger source to a switchbox when the trigger source
has already been assigned to another switchbox.
Addressing a module (card) in a switchbox that is not part of the switchbox.
Attempting to address a channel of a module in a switchbox that is not
supported by the module (e.g., channel 99 of a multiplexer module).
Sending a command to a module (card) in a switchbox that is unsupported
by the module.
Executing a scan without the INIT command.
Attempting to address more channels than available in the switchbox.
Invalid channel(s) specified in SCAN <channel_list> command. Attempting to
begin scanning when no valid <channel_list> is defined.
Sending a command to a module (card) in a switchbox that is not supported
by the module or switchbox.
Sending a command requiring a <channel_list> without the <channel_list>.
